#f77994 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f77994 is composed of 96.9% red, 47.5%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51% magenta, 40.1%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 347.1 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 72.2%. #f77994 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ff2ff with #ef0029.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#f77994 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f77994 has RGB values of R:247, G:121,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.4,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16218516.

Shades and Tints of #f77994
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0104 is the darkest color, while #fffb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#f77994
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bbb5b6 is the less saturated color, while #fc7491 is the most saturated one.
